How is Child Support Calculated?

Many times as an experienced New Jersey Child Support Lawyer, I am asked how the court calculates child support payments.

  • New Jersey has their own guidelines for child support calculations.
  • If one of the parties makes over $3500 a week, the guidelines are not fully followed

What if the Other Parent is Not Paying the Court Ordered Child Support?

Many times as an experienced New Jersey Child Support Attorney, I am asked what can happen if you do not pay your court ordered child support payments.

  • If you do not pay your child support, you will have a warrant placed out for your arrest and you can be kept in jail until fully paid.
  • Your passport will be revoked if you stop paying child support.
  • You can lose your driver’s license if you do not pay your court ordered child support.
